Output 91afc234a7f7b31c07f6e62c5859d0c2ec36ac185ed90b9f08e33f01856df9d7:4

value
79588446
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c558f75ec989cc7ec9a4a8b716e37f9bd2be86c3 OP_EQUALVERIFY OP_CHECKSIG
address
1JzUhH49NYMxMAVsti1ZrHaYEo1bPXEvCX
transaction
91afc234a7f7b31c07f6e62c5859d0c2ec36ac185ed90b9f08e33f01856df9d7
spent
true